  1. GPA Versus Seating Location. A professor wanted to know whether there was a difference in students’ grade point averages (GPA) depending on whether they sit in the front half of the classroom versus the back half of the classroom. In a previous semester, a random sample of students was selected from the front of a classroom and another random sample was selected from the back of a classroom and each student’s current GPA was recorded. The data provided in StatCrunch represent the GPAs from each random sample. At the 0.01 significance level, can the professor conclude from these data that the mean GPA for front sitters is different from than back sitters?

What is (are) the parameter(s) of interest? Choose one of the following symbols (m (the mean of one sample); mD(the mean difference from a paired (dependent) samples);m1 - m2 (the mean difference of two independent samples) and describe the parameter in context of this question in one sentence

It is given that the professor wants to test whether the mean GPA for front sitters is different from than back sitters.

Given that first sample is selected from front of a classroom and then second sample was selected from the back of a classroom

so, we have two independent samples

For this hypothesis test, the population parameter is m1-mu2 where m1 and m2 are population means for each sample.

m is not correct answer because we use it only for single sample, but here we have two samples

mD is not correct answer because it is only used for dependent samples, but here we have independent samples
